Question

which property do metalloids share with nonmetals?
both are gases at room temperature.
both can react to form acidic compounds.
both are very poor electrical conductors.
both can be pounded into thin sheets.

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

Metalloids and non - metals can react to form acidic compounds. Not all are gases at room temperature. Some metalloids are semi - conductors, not very poor conductors. Non - metals and metalloids are generally brittle and can't be pounded into thin sheets (malleability is a metallic property).

Answer:

Both can react to form acidic compounds.
